Holiday Talking Points for The Aragon Development
Our Goal: Move from "signing a petition" to "writing a personal letter."
1. The "Why Now" (The Urgency)
We can’t wait for the Public Hearing, because there might not even be one! Even by the time a Public Hearing is scheduled, the project may already be a “done deal" negotiated behind the doors of the Planning Department.
Influence the Design: Now is the time to influence the proposal before it gets finalized. We cannot assume Council will reject it just because it feels "wrong" to us.
2. The Power of Personal Letters
Petitions vs. Letters: While petitions show numbers, personal letters to the Mayor, Council and Planning carry significantly more weight.
Your Voice Matters: Individual emails to the Mayor and Council are read and filed as part of the official record. They show a level of commitment that a signature doesn't.
3. Key Issues to Mention
Scale and Density: The current proposal is significantly larger than what was originally envisioned for our neighborhood.
Neighborhood Character: Ask if this design truly fits the long-term vision of Saanich or if it’s just a "finished deal" being handed to us.
Transparency: We want to ensure the Planning Department is listening to residents, not just the developer (Aragon).
4. What You Can Do in the Next Couple of Weeks over the Christmas Break.
Spread the Word: Mention the development at holiday gatherings. Many neighbors may not realize how far along the process actually is, or even know about it!
Prepare for January: In the New Year, we will be focusing on a coordinated letter-writing campaign, but we will need your help for this. We will update you all in the first week of January.
